Joseph Witt commented on NIFI-1192: ----------------------------------- There is a situation in which some Kafka broker we're trying to talk to has a poorly behaving zookeeper associated with it. It is presently causing our client to block which is creating poor behavior in NiFi. There do appear to be, as Oleg points out, many other kafka configuration properties which could be set and potentially yield better client behavior (not block indefinitely). We need to identify which those are and promote them to first class NiFi Processor Properties.
